The album earned a total of 514.01 million on-demand streams in the debut week, that resulted in the largest streaming week of 2023 for any album and the fourth-largest ever. [64] For All the Dogs is Drake's thirteenth number-one album in the US. [64] All 23 tracks debuted on the Billboard Hot 100, with seven of them appearing in the top-ten.
